David Kervin
President, co-founder

Mr. Kervin is the president of Covenant Security International, LLC. (CSI), responsible for driving global strategic development.

A combat veteran of the US Marine Corps, Mr. Kervin served 12 years in a variety of Infantry and Counterintelligence billets. Prior to joining Covenant, he staffed and led high-risk international government operations and Fortune 100 security programs for 8 years.

Mr. Kervin has authored and delivered training programs for U.S. government agencies, allied nation personnel and private concerns. He’s also been a guest speaker at the John F. Kennedy School of Government, Harvard University (Harvard Defense and Security Initiative).

Mr. Kervin attended Arizona State University in Tempe, Arizona, where he studied political science.

Tom Buchino
Vice President,Training, co-founder

Mr. Buchino is responsible for global training programs.

Mr. Buchino is a retired 23-year combat veteran of the U.S. Army. He served 17 years as a Special Forces operator in the U.S. Army Special Forces regiment. Prior to Covenant, Mr. Buchino served as the director of high threat training for an internationally recognized defense services company. He was responsible for comprehensive training programs for U.S. Department of State high threat protection details as well as the contracted pre-deployment training for U.S. Special Operations units.

Mr. Buchino has a Bachelor of Science from Liberty University.

Curt Smith
Vice President, Business Administration, co-founder

Mr. Smith is responsible for all aspects of back-office and business process.

Mr. Smith is retired from the U.S. Marine Corps with over 20 years service where he held senior positions in financial management, fund/ industrial accounting, and logistics/sustainment planning and execution. Prior to Covenant, Mr. Smith served in various management positions within industry and government directly supporting all United States Armed Forces.

Mr. Smith was recognized by the Secretary of Defense (SECDEF) for his efforts to introduce best business practices as a financial management officer in the Marine Corps.

Mr. Smith holds a Masters in Business Administration (MBA) from Averett University and a Bachelors of Science/Finance from Chapman University.

Stephen (Steve) L. Simmons
Managing Director, West Africa

In his current position, Mr. Simmons is responsible for the management and quality control of all activities in West Africa leading our team of regional subject matter experts there.

Mr. Simmons’ career spans over 30 years and includes law enforcement, investigative, security leadership and operations management in both the corporate and government sectors. Prior to Covenant, Mr. Simmons held positions with the Georgia Bureau of Investigation (GBI), Mobil Corporation and ExxonMobil, where he retired as the Manager of all African security operations.

Mr. Simmons holds a bachelor’s of Accounting from the University of Notre Dame.

Angela Williams-Tasky
Managing Director
Critical Infrastructure Protection
Covenant Security International, LLC.

Ms. Williams-Tasky is responsible for leadership and strategic direction as the Managing Director of CSI’s Critical Infrastructure Protection (CIP) division.

Ms. Williams-Tasky has extensive technical and implementation experience in security, regulatory compliance, and criminal justice within corporate, government, and industrial environments.  Prior to joining CSI, Ms. Williams-Tasky provided pre-decision analysis and guidance to senior officials in both the Chemical Security Compliance Division (responsible for the Chemical Facility Anti-Terrorism Standards, CFATS) and the Protective Security Advisor Program within the Office of the Assistant Secretary for Infrastructure Protection of the Department of Homeland Security (DHS) during the initial stand-up and operational implementation phases.  Prior to this assignment, Ms. Williams-Tasky served as both a sworn Police Officer and Investigator for the University of Nevada Reno before being selected as a Special Agent with the United States Secret Service.  She has also managed large and complex projects for a variety of venues representing Fortune 500 businesses and major event facilities.

Ms. Williams-Tasky holds a BA in Criminal Justice and is currently completing a Masters in Business Administration. She is an active member of the American Society for Industrial Security (ASIS) and is board certified in security management as a Certified Protection Professional (CPP).

Joe Trindal
Director

Mr. Joe Trindal is responsible for operations and quality assurance as the Director of CSI’s Critical Infrastructure Protection (CIP) division.

Prior to Covenant Security, Mr. Trindal was the Special Agent in Charge of the Inspections & Enforcement Branch, Infrastructure Security Compliance Division, Department of Homeland Security (DHS).  As the Branch Chief, he was instrumental in standing up the Office of Infrastructure Protection’s Chemical Facility Anti-Terrorism Standards (CFATS) regulatory regime.  With the creation of DHS, Mr. Trindal served as the National Capital Region Director for the Federal Protective Service commanding a law enforcement/protective security organization of nearly 400 full time employees and 5,700 contract security guards responsible for protecting nearly 750 federal facilities and about 300,000 federal employees and contractors.

For 20 years, Mr. Trindal served with distinction in the U.S. Marshals Service attaining the positions of Chief Deputy U.S. Marshal and Incident Commander for the Emergency Response Team.  Mr. Trindal has led a number of high profile protective and fugitive operations as well as serving as federal law enforcement liaison to USAF Strategic Air Command for nuclear weapons security.

Mr. Trindal holds undergraduate degrees in Police Science and Criminal Justice as well as nearing completion of master’s degree requirements in Public Administration.  Mr. Trindal is also a distinguished veteran of the U.S. Marine Corps.

Michael Shanklin
Director of Development
Africa and Middle East

Mr Shanklin is responsible for the development of customer relationships, regional business initiatives and the provision of niche consulting expertise for CSI clientele.

With over 30+ years of security and counter-terrorism experience, Mr. Shanklin is recognized as one of the world’s foremost experts on threat assessment and crisis management.  Mr. Shanklin served over a decade with the Central Intelligence Agency, where he managed large and complex projects in Europe, the Middle East, Africa and advised senior members of the state and defense departments, in addition to multiple intelligence agencies. Prior to his CIA service, he retired honorably from the US Marine Corps where he served in both the enlisted and commissioned officer ranks, with 21 years of service in the counterintelligence field.

His exceptional service was recognized with the agency’s second highest award, The Intelligence Star Medal of Valor.  Since 1995, Mr. Shanklin has consulted on a wide range of projects for Fortune 250 companies with a focus on planning, threat assessment and crisis response.

Mr. Shanklin is a graduate of Chapman College with a B.S. in Political Science

Frank Rossi
Director of Training

Mr. Rossi is responsible for all operations and tactical supervision of training programs.

Mr. Rossi is a retired 21-year combat veteran of the U.S. Army. He served 14 of those as a Special Forces operator in the U.S. Army Special Forces regiment. Prior to joining Covenant, Mr. Rossi worked as a senior instructor on a joint tactical Human Intelligence (HUMINT) training program.

Mr. Rossi’s leadership experience ranges from serving as an advisor in Africa, Asia, Southeast Asia, Europe and the Middle East to the Combined Joint Special Operations Task Force (CJSOTF) Afghanistan Military Liaison Officer (MLO) for Advanced Special Operations (ASO) for Afghanistan.

Mr. Rossi attended Troy State University.
